How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Parkwood?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Parkwood Studio Apartments | $1,852 | $1,199 | $9,929 |
Parkwood 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,959 | $540 | $6,859 |
Parkwood 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,513 | $965 | $6,238 |
Parkwood 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,330 | $930 | $9,660 |
Parkwood 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,025 | $2,015 | $2,035 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Parkwood
How much are Studio apartments in Parkwood?
There are currently 32 Studio Apartments in Parkwood with rent ranges from $1,199 to $9,929 with an average price of $1,852.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Parkwood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Parkwood ranges from $540 to $6,859 with an average monthly rent of $1,959.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Parkwood c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Parkwood range from $965 to $6,238.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,513.
How expensive are Parkwood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 38 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Parkwood on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$930 to $9,660 - averaging $3,330 for the location.
